#7602e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7602e4 is composed of 46.3% red, 0.8%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 45.1%. #7602e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ec04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7602e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7602e4 has RGB values of R:118, G:2,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7733988.

Shades and Tints of #7602e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000e is the darkest color, while #fcf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7602e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736c7a is the less saturated color, while #7602e4 is the most saturated one.
